Cornerstone 与 Mac OS X 版本

发布于 2024-08-24 14:25:16 字数 374 浏览 13 评论 0原文

我在命令行上使用 svn 已有 5 年多了,但我正在考虑切换到 GUI。 Mac 颠覆应用程序的两个王者似乎是 Versions基石。我看到的大多数比较两者的评论/评论都可以追溯到 2008 年,当时 Cornerstone 首次发布。现在已经是 2010 年了,这两款应用程序都发生了重大变化。

过去一周我一直在运行这两个应用程序的试用版,但我仍然无法下定决心。您会推荐哪一个,为什么?

I've been using svn on the command line for 5+ years, but I'm thinking of switching to GUI. The two kings of Mac subversion apps seem to be Versions and Cornerstone. Most of the reviews/comments I've seen comparing the two are from way back in 2008, when Cornerstone was first released. It's now 2010, and both apps have undergone significant changes.

I've been running trial copies of both apps for the past week, and I still can't make up my mind. Which would you recommend and why?

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(14

暮年 2024-08-31 14:25:16

Cornerstone 已经推出几年了,第二版刚刚发布。它现在是迄今为止最有价值、速度最快且功能丰富的 Mac Subversion 客户端。仅合并功能和注释就很棒。我从来没有见过如此酷的方式,你可以在比较时单击一个文本块,并在一个令人惊叹的用户界面中显示该块的日志消息以及你需要的所有统计信息,太棒了。

说真的,我极力推荐这个工具。它与版本不同。

Cornerstone has been out a few years and version 2 was just released. It is now by far the best value, fastest and feature rich Subversion client for the Mac. The merge features and annotations alone are awesome. I have never seen such a cool take on either of them and the way you can just click a block of text when comparing and have the log message displayed for that block together with all the statistical information you'll ever need in a stunning UI, it's just awesome.

Seriously I can't recommend this tool enough. It is in a different league to Versions.

深海里的那抹蓝 2024-08-31 14:25:16

我已经尝试过这两种方法,并且更喜欢 Cornerstone,主要是因为它具有更优越的文件差异界面。

使用 Cornerstone,您可以双击提交列表中的任何文件,它会立即显示您的版本与存储库版本的差异。这使得在签入之前快速对更改进行代码审查变得非常容易。

据我所知,对于版本,您必须按 Ctrl-D,然后按比较,然后等待几秒钟,然后才能加载版本差异工具。

I've tried both and like Cornerstone better, mainly because it has a far superior file-diff interface.

With Cornerstone, you can double-click on any file in your commit-list and it instantly brings up a diff of your version vs the repository version. This makes it very easy to quickly code-review your changes before checking in.

With Versions, as far as I can tell, you have to hit Ctrl-D, then hit Compare, and then wait a good few seconds before it loads up the diff tool.

在巴黎塔顶看东京樱花 2024-08-31 14:25:16

阅读本文并查看 CornerStone 2.0 和版本后,Corner Stone 凭借其文件比较的简单性而获胜。

对于版本,我必须下载或安装 XCode(或其他东西)。 Cornerstone 内置了它,根据我的口味,Cornerstones 文件比较是我见过的对于普通用户来说最好的。添加和删​​除的内容立即一目了然。

我还没有尝试过分支和合并,但似乎基石已经做出了巨大的推动。

After reading this and looking at CornerStone 2.0 and Versions, Corner Stone won on just the simplicity of their file compare.

With versions I have to download or install XCode (or something else). Cornerstone had it built in, and for my tastes the Cornerstones file compare is the best I've seen for a casual user. It's just immediately clear what was added and deleted.

I haven't tried the branch and merge but it seems Cornerstone has made that a big push.

她如夕阳 2024-08-31 14:25:16

我想添加 Cornerstone 2 现在有分支 &合并,这是版本上真正的1-up。令人恼火的是,我在发布之前购买了版本,所以我感到有点刺痛:-(

I'd like to add Cornerstone 2 now has branch & merge, which is a real 1-up on Versions. Irritatingly I bought Versions just before that release so I feel a little stung :-(

╰ゝ天使的微笑 2024-08-31 14:25:16

几年前我购买了 Cornerstone,主要是因为我听说了他们的支持。我曾多次联系支持人员,一次或两次是因为错误,多次是提出问题。他们总是非常敏感,我对我的选择很满意。

如果您是学生,Cornerstone 还可以享受很好的教育折扣。

我确实希望在查看文件夹的历史记录时,您可以像在 Windows 上的 Tortoise 中一样查看该文件夹中各个文件的更改。

I purchased Cornerstone several years ago, primarily because I had heard good things about their support. I have contacted support several times, once or twice with bugs and several times to ask questions. They were always very responsive, and I've been happy with my choice.

Cornerstone also has a good educational discount if you're a student.

I do wish that when viewing the history of a folder you could view the changes to individual files within that folder the way you can in Tortoise on Windows.

短叹 2024-08-31 14:25:16

我更喜欢版本 GUI。 Cornerstone 有更多功能,但我不需要它们,所以它们往往会妨碍我。

另外,万花筒是一个很棒的文本比较工具,它们可以完美地协同工作。

我希望 XCode 4 会让这两者都过时……也许有一天(叹气)。

I like Versions GUI more. Cornerstone has more features, but I don't NEED them, so they tend to get in the way.

Plus Kaleidoscope is an AWESOME text comparison tool and they work beautifully together.

I was hoping that XCode 4 would make both obsolete... maybe one day (sigh).

独自←快乐 2024-08-31 14:25:16

基石赢了。我们做了一次猛烈的打击,基石 1.5 对于我们经验丰富的团队成员和生产工程师(更休闲的 SVN 人员)来说要好得多

Cornerstone won. We did a smack down and cornerstone 1.5 was far better both for our experienced team members and our production engineers ( more casual SVNers )

满身野味 2024-08-31 14:25:16

Cornerstone 不进行 svn 合并。对我来说,这是一个交易杀手(将分支的修订合并到主干中?不)。

如果您所需要做的就是提交、浏览和结帐,那么 Cornerstone 很性感且很棒,我比版本更喜欢 UI。

对于日常使用——分支、标记、合并——我最喜欢 SmartSVN,它是跨平台的。 UI 没那么性感。

Cornerstone doesn't do svn merges. For me that's a deal killer (merging revisions from a a branch into the trunk? nope).

If all you need to do is commit and browse and checkout, Cornerstone is sexy and awesome, I like the UI better than Versions.

For daily usage -- branching, tagging, merging -- I like SmartSVN best and it's cross platform. UI isn't as sexy.

月野兔 2024-08-31 14:25:16

在花了几天时间与竞争产品所包含的版本进行评估后,我们刚刚购买了 Cornerstone 2 的 15 个许可证。值得一提的是,《基石 2》与其他所有游戏都属于不同的联盟。整个应用程序的构思非常巧妙,常常令人难以置信。从浏览工作副本到出色的合并支持,它只是没有变得更好。它超级快且易于使用。值得一提的是注释,这使得竞赛所做的其他一切看起来过时且蹩脚。继续 Zennaware 的出色工作。

We just bought 15 licenses of Cornerstone 2 after spending a few days evaluating it against the competing products included Versions. Save to say, Cornerstone 2 is in a different league to everything else. The entire application has been so well conceived it often boggles the mind. From browsing your working copy to awesome merge support, it just does not get any better. It's super fast and easy to use. Worth mentioning are the annotations as well, which make everything else the competition has done look dated and lame. Keep up the amazing work Zennaware.

初相遇 2024-08-31 14:25:16

我尝试了基石2和版本。

最后我选择了基石 2,因为它提供了更直观的工作流程。您可以轻松添加文件,apple + Enter 查看差异,然后 apple + t 提交。我发现在基石中查看差异信息更容易,如果有意义的话,感觉更像是苹果应用程序。

I tried both cornerstone 2 and versions.

In the end I went with cornerstone 2 as it provided a more intuitive workflow. You can easily add a file, apple + enter to see the diff and then apple + t to commit. I found it easier to see the diff information in cornerstone and it felt more like an apple application if that makes sense.

两仪 2024-08-31 14:25:16

另一个考虑因素是 SVN 1.7 支持。 Cornerstone 自 2012 年 2 月中旬起就有了此功能。版本中何时支持此功能尚无官方日期。

--叹气-- 我拥有版本,但本周将购买基石,因为我不能再等待了。

Another consideration is SVN 1.7 support. Cornerstone has had this feature since mid February, 2012. No official date for when this will be supported in Versions.

--sigh-- I own Versions, but will be purchasing Cornerstone this week because I just can't wait any longer.

眼眸 2024-08-31 14:25:16

Cornerstone 为 diff 找了这样一个让人看着很痛苦的借口。等不及试用期结束并继续测试其他东西。

Cornerstone has such an excuse for diff that is painful to watch. Can't wait for trial to expire and move on, testing something else.

苏璃陌 2024-08-31 14:25:16

尝试一下 SmartSvn,它比其他任何一个都有更多的功能和更强大的方式。我也使用 svnx,但是 UI 很糟糕。

Try SmartSvn, it has much more features and way more powerful then any of those. I also use svnx, however the UI is awful.

此刻的回忆 2024-08-31 14:25:16

我使用版本是因为它适合我的需求,在购买之前我什至从未听说过基石。

如果您无法下定决心,这可能意味着两者都足够适合您,因此请选择最便宜的选项,或提供最好支持的选项。 (我不知道两者的支持如何,从来不需要任何支持)

I'm using versions because it suits my needs and I never even heard of cornerstone before i bought it.

If you cannot make up your mind that probably means that both work well enough for you, so go with the cheapes option, or the one with the best support. (i have no idea how the support on either is, never needed any)

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文